Cooling-Off Rule

Regulation that allows consumers a set period to cancel contracts or purchases without penalty, often applied to door-to-door sales and certain loans.

Door-to-door Sales

The direct selling method where salespersons solicit business by visiting households or businesses without prior appointment.

The Federal Trade Commission's Cooling-Off Rule gives consumers three days to cancel purchases they make from salespeople who come to their homes.The salesperson must notify the consumer,both verbally and in writing,that the sales transaction may be canceled,and the consumer must be notified in writing in the same language in which the oral negotiations were conducted.
